SeaWorld Orlando’s Christmas Celebration 2020

SeaWorld’s Christmas Celebration, taking place November 14 through December 31, will transform the park into a winter wonderland with more than three million sparkling lights and park-wide holiday activities.

To bring the merriment to life, SeaWorld’s creative team consulted with medical experts to offer a modified event with required reservations and limited capacity that celebrates the spirit of the season safely.

This seasonal event features open-air entertainment and experiences as well as enhanced health, safety measures, including increased cleaning and sanitation, temperature checks, face-covering requirements, and physical distancing.

Included in park admission, park guests can safely enjoy the sights, sounds, and tastes of the holiday season with specialty shopping, physically distant holiday shows, tasty holiday treats, and beloved holiday traditions.

Ice Skating at Bayside Stadium

All-new for this year, guests can now experience outdoor ice skating! You and your family can skate alongside the water of SeaWorld’s central lagoon throughout the day in a beautiful winter wonderland. Capacity will be limited to promote physical distancing and all guests must wear crew length socks and gloves. Additional charge required which includes rental of ice skates, socks, and gloves can also be purchased.

Hanukkah Celebration

This year, SeaWorld will be celebrating more holidays than ever before. For the first year ever, SeaWorld Orlando will be celebrating the festival of lights! From December 10 through 18, gather with your friends and family in a socially distant experience to view the traditional lighting of the menorah throughout Hanukkah.

Kwanzaa Festivities

Another new experience for the holidays this year, SeaWorld will celebrate the festivities of Kwanzaa! Taking place December 26through January 1, guests can enjoy a joyous time of reflection and celebration of African heritage with the nightly lighting of the kinara.

Photos with Santa Claus

Take a visit to the top of the world to meet the Arctic’s most famous resident, Santa Claus, at SeaWorld’s Wild Arctic for a safe alternative to family photos with everyone’s favorite jolly elf! One party at a time will greet Santa in the expansive family room and have the opportunity to sit (physically distant) in Santa’s sleigh with Santa seated above and behind, separated by a plexiglass partition. *Photo packages available.

Holiday Shows at SeaWorld Orlando’s Christmas Celebration

Rudolph’s Movie Experience

Rudolph and his friends star in this movie that will get the entire family in the holiday spirit, playing daily in the Sea Port Theater with limited capacity and physical distancing. This special movie experience is approximately 10 minutes long and begins every 30 minutes.

Sea of Trees

Take a walk through a wintery, watery wonderland, and immerse yourself in the expansive holiday Sea of Trees Located in SeaWorld’s lagoon where the glistening forest sparkles to music and lights up the water—and your eyes. With 360-degree views from around the park, there is plenty of space to enjoy safe physical distancing. As the lights dance to holiday classics, your heart will soar with wonder and delight at this truly awe-inspiring Christmas treat. Plus, a magnificent centerpiece towers 70 feet above the water.

Winter Wonderland on Ice

Christmas comes to life on a stage of ice, jewels and lights as skaters dazzle and delight in a show-stopping, ice skating extravaganza with physically distant seating arrangements. A sea of sparkling trees and towering fountains dancing in the background come together to create a don’t-miss experience for the holidays that the entire family will enjoy.

Special Events at SeaWorld Orlando’s Christmas Celebration

Rudolph’s Christmas Town

Returning for another year of festive fun, guests can immerse themselves in the story of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er at Rudolph’s Christmas Town. Stroll outdoors past life-size story book vignettes featuring the classic tale, and meet beloved characters including Rudolph and Bumble. This attraction has a limited capacity to promote physical distancing.

Christmas Market

Nestled along the park’s Bayside Pathway, the Christmas market features festive entertainment and delicious culinary delights from an all-NEW chef and mixologist created holiday menu. Guests will also encounter playful elves and a charming model train village. Relax near the warm glow of the fire pit with a fan-favorite seasonal beer or mulled wine, or chose from a variety of NEW unique holiday-inspired beverages rooted in classic Christmas traditions.  Limited capacity and physical distancing measures will be in place. These unique limited-time options include specialty cocktails like the “Winter Wonderland Hot Toddy” made with winter cider, honey whiskey, and a chain infusion, and the festive “Peppermint Cocoa” made with peppermint schnapps.

The spirit of the season is in every bite of holiday food pairings throughout the park such as the ale-cured and smoke-cured pork slider, the mini chicken philly, or the “Traditional Christmas Dinner Stack” which layers roasted turkey, stuffing, mashed potatoes, gravy, and cranberry sauce over texas toast.  The market also features a variety of peppermint desserts like the peppermint bark cheesecake.
